Product was successfully added to your shopping cart.
Dynamic hashing in data structure.
Long overflow chains can develop and degrade performance.
Dynamic hashing in data structure. Mar 17, 2025 · The dynamic hashing method is used to overcome the problems of static hashing like bucket overflow. Situation: Bucket (primary page) becomes full. . It avoids the problems of overflow and poor key distribution that can occur with static hashing, and it eliminates the need for costly rehashing operations. Long overflow chains can develop and degrade performance. Jan 17, 2025 · This blog post explores the concepts of static and dynamic hashing techniques in data structures, detailing their definitions, advantages, disadvantages, and real-world applications. Discover the concept of Dynamic Hashing in DBMS, how to search a key, insert a new record, and understand its pros and cons. This method makes hashing dynamic, allowing for insertion and deletion without causing performance issues. What is Dynamic Hashing in DBMS? The dynamic hashing approach is used to solve problems like bucket overflow that can occur with static hashing. Linear hashing: add one more bucket to increase hash capacity. If file grows, we need a dynamic hashing method to maintain the above relationship. Extensible Hashing: double the number of buckets when needed. As the number of records increases or decreases, data buckets grow or shrink in this manner. This comprehensive guide includes detailed examples for better understanding. In this method, data buckets grow or shrink as the records increases or decreases. In summary, dynamic hashing provides a flexible and efficient method for managing hash tables with a changing number of records. ieyvdkujfrqpudjbcfgyekkhsbiusvoijmvdfupgpijucwwpii